I wanted to ask if anyone has had experience with a problem I am having with importing a .cas file generated in pointwise to fluent. The grid configration allows some mirroring of elements but I find that when I mirror elements as apposed to build the whole grid from scratch, fluent comes with an error 'no face for the given nodes'. If I build the whole mesh from scratch, there are no problems importing the mesh. would like to know why this is the case. thanks in advance
